Output e936956d0d56e29587fbefa76695093e5833364ce117fea80d51106940341cb2:177

value
78375
script pubkey
OP_0 OP_PUSHBYTES_32 521276b64f9fae6c4a2d1adbeed3eeb8646c8e9d881ae437235b3f35afab8603
address
bc1q2gf8ddj0n7hxcj3drtd7a5lwhpjxer5a3qdwgdertvlnttatscpsd6c6qm
transaction
e936956d0d56e29587fbefa76695093e5833364ce117fea80d51106940341cb2
confirmations
43204
spent
true